Condividi tramite


Remove-CsImFilterConfiguration

 

Ultima modifica dell'argomento: 2012-03-27

Consente di rimuovere la configurazione del filtro di messaggistica istantanea specificata. Le impostazioni del filtro IM vengono utilizzate per impedire agli utenti di inviare messaggi istantanei contenenti collegamenti ipertestuali.

Sintassi

Remove-CsImFilterConfiguration -Identity <XdsIdentity> [-Confirm [<SwitchParameter>]] [-Force <SwitchParameter>] [-WhatIf [<SwitchParameter>]]

Descrizione dettagliata

Quando si inviano messaggi istantanei, gli utenti possono incorporare nel testo del messaggio un URI (Uniform Resource Identifier) per rimandare a una condivisione o a un sito Web specifico gli altri partecipanti alla conversazione. È possibile configurare Microsoft Lync Server 2010 in modo che i collegamenti ipertestuali con determinati prefissi vengano bloccati o non risultino attivi. In altri termini, i partecipanti non possono semplicemente fare clic sul collegamento per accedere al sito a cui fa riferimento l'URI, ma devono copiare e incollare manualmente il collegamento in un browser.

Il cmdlet Remove-CsImFilterConfiguration consente di rimuovere le impostazioni del filtro IM per una determinata identità, ad esempio, un sito specifico. L'utilizzo di questo cmdlet per l'identità Global consente di ripristinare le impostazioni predefinite nella configurazione globale.

Utenti autorizzati a utilizzare questo cmdlet: per impostazione predefinita, il cmdlet Remove-CsImFilterConfiguration può essere utilizzato localmente dai membri dei seguenti gruppi: RTCUniversalServerAdmins. Per ottenere un elenco di tutti i ruoli RBAC (controllo dell'accesso basato sui ruoli) a cui è stato assegnato questo cmdlet (inclusi eventuali ruoli RBAC personalizzati), utilizzare il seguente comando dal prompt di Windows PowerShell:

Get-CsAdminRole | Where-Object {$_.Cmdlets –match "Remove-CsImFilterConfiguration"}

Parametri

Parametro Obbligatorio Tipo Descrizione

Identity

Obbligatorio

XdsIdentity

L'identità univoca della configurazione da rimuovere. Per questo cmdlet Identity sarà Global o Site:<nome sito>, in cui <nome sito> indica il nome del sito a cui sono applicate le impostazioni.

Tipo di dati completi: Microsoft.Rtc.Management.Xds.XdsIdentity

Force

Facoltativo

Parametro opzionale

Consente di evitare la visualizzazione delle richieste di conferma che altrimenti verrebbero visualizzate prima che vengano apportate le modifiche.

WhatIf

Facoltativo

Parametro opzionale

Descrive ciò che accadrebbe se si eseguisse il comando senza eseguirlo realmente.

Confirm

Facoltativo

Parametro opzionale

Viene visualizzata una richiesta di conferma prima di eseguire il comando.

Tipi di input

Oggetto Microsoft.Rtc.Management.WritableConfig.Settings.ImFilter.ImFilterConfiguration. Accetta l'input tramite pipeline degli oggetti configurazione filtro IM.

Tipi restituiti

Consente di rimuovere un oggetto di tipo Microsoft.Rtc.Management.WritableConfig.Settings.ImFilter.ImFilterConfiguration.

Esempio

-------------------------- Esempio 1 --------------------------

Remove-CsImFilterConfiguration -Identity site:Redmond

Nell'Esempio 1, viene utilizzato il cmdlet Remove-CsImFilterConfiguration per rimuovere la configurazione del filtro IM con Identity site:Redmond. Quando da un sito viene rimossa una configurazione del filtro IM, per quel sito verranno automaticamente utilizzate le impostazioni globali.

-------------------------- Esempio 2 --------------------------

Get-CsImFilterConfiguration -Filter site:* | Remove-CsImFilterConfiguration

Nell'Esempio 2 vengono rimosse tutte le configurazioni del filtro IM nell'ambito del sito. Per ottenere questo risultato, il comando utilizza il cmdlet Get-CsImFilterConfiguration e il parametro Filter per ottenere tutte le configurazioni nell'ambito del sito; il valore con caratteri jolly site:* indica al cmdlet Get-CsImFilterConfiguration che deve restituire solo quelle impostazioni la cui identità inizia con site:. La raccolta di configurazioni filtrata viene quindi inviata tramite pipe al cmdlet Remove-CsImFilterConfiguration che elimina ogni configurazione nella raccolta.